
Red Twig Dogwood
- Botanical Name
- Cornus sericea
- Min Zone
- 2
- Max Zone
- 7
- Height
- 7 to 9 feet
- Width
- Up to 10 feet
- Flowers
- Late May to Early June: dull white, flat topped cyme, sporatic through the summer
- Fruit
- White drupe
- Fall Color
- Reddish-purple
- Light
- Full sun to light shade
- Soil
- Moist (prefers), adaptable
- Planting & Care
- Transplants easily
- Prune out older canes for color and vigor
- Problems
- Twig canker, septoria leaf spot, scale
- Varieties
- Flaviramea - yellow twig dogwood
- Kelseyi - dwarf to 3 feet
- Silver and Gold - yellow stems, variegated leaves with an irregular yellow border
